Ce3PrO8 is a mixed rare-earth oxide ceramic compound combining cerium and praseodymium oxides, belonging to the family of lanthanide-based ceramics. This material is primarily investigated in research contexts for applications requiring high-temperature stability and ionic conductivity, particularly in solid oxide fuel cells (SOFCs) and advanced thermal management systems where rare-earth doping enhances material performance compared to conventional pure oxide ceramics.
